The 8 1/4″ Lambert Kay Aortic Anastomosis Clamp is a precision-engineered vascular clamp designed to assist surgeons during delicate aortic procedures requiring accurate vessel control and secure handling. Developed for aortic anastomosis and cardiovascular reconstruction, this specialized clamp provides dependable performance in complex cardiac and vascular surgical environments.
This instrument is commonly used in cardiovascular surgery, aortic reconstruction, vascular grafting, arterial anastomosis, bypass procedures, and other cardiac surgical interventions where temporary occlusion and controlled manipulation of the aorta are required. Its specialized design allows surgeons to create a stable operative field while performing precise suturing and vascular repair techniques.

Product Specifications
| Specification | Details |
|---|---|
| Product Name | 8 1/4″ Lambert Kay Aortic Anastomosis Clamp |
| Instrument Type | Aortic Anastomosis Clamp |
| Pattern | Lambert Kay |
| Overall Length | 8 1/4″ (Approximately 21 cm) |
| Jaw Style | Aortic Vascular Clamping Jaw |
| Material | Surgical Grade Stainless Steel |
| Finish | Satin / Matte Finish |
| Handle Type | Finger Ring Handle |
| Locking Mechanism | Ratchet Lock |
| Sterility | Supplied Non-Sterile |
| Reusable | Yes |
| Sterilization | Steam Autoclave Compatible |
| Specialty | Cardiovascular Surgery |
| Applications | Aortic Anastomosis, Vascular Reconstruction, Cardiac Surgery, Aortic Procedures |

3. What is the purpose of an anastomosis clamp?
An anastomosis clamp helps surgeons temporarily control vessels, creating a stable field for connecting or repairing vascular structures.
